wpDataTables Key Features

✨ Seamless Data Sourcing and Synchronization

wpDataTables makes integrating external data refreshingly simple. You can create tables directly from public or private Google Sheets. This is a huge benefit because synchronization happens automatically, keeping your published tables always current.

For more advanced integration, you can connect to external databases, including MySQL, MSSQL, and PostgreSQL. You can import and visualize that complex data easily within your WordPress site. Furthermore, the flexibility extends to connecting data from virtually any API source, ensuring full data compatibility.

✨ Advanced Filtering and Fixed Layouts

When dealing with large datasets, providing excellent user experience is crucial. The advanced filtering tools let your users search tables by specific criteria. They can search by text, filter by date ranges, or select values using dropdowns and checkboxes right on your website.

To prevent confusion while scrolling, you can fix headers and columns in place. This feature ensures that column titles remain visible, no matter how far down a user browses. Fixed layouts allow visitors to compare values and navigate complex tables seamlessly.

✨ Interactive Chart Building

Sometimes raw numbers need visual context to tell the full story. Beyond tables, wpDataTables helps you build dynamic, interactive charts. You have plenty of choices to accurately represent your data using 5 different chart engines.

With access to 80 different chart types, you can choose the right visualization for any situation. Whether you need to illustrate sales trends or compare complex statistics, turning your table data into a professional chart is quick and effective.

💡 Conditional Formatting for Insight 💡

Highlighting key information saves users time and guides their attention. Conditional formatting allows you to set specific criteria for table values. When a condition is met, the relevant cell or row will automatically highlight.

This is invaluable for searching large datasets without manual scanning. For example, you can highlight sales figures above a certain threshold or flag records that need attention. Setting these conditions helps you quickly gain insights from huge amounts of data.

✨ Streamlined Table Management

As your website grows, so does your collection of data tables. wpDataTables helps you keep your workflow organized and accessible. You can arrange and group all your tables into structured folders and subfolders directly in the dashboard.

This organizational tool makes managing hundreds of tables efficient. To find specific data quickly, you can use the seamless search functionality within the folders. A clean backend environment means less time managing files and more time providing data to your audience.

✨ Direct Editing and Calculations

You don't need external programs to maintain your data. wpDataTables offers Excel-like editing capabilities right within WordPress. You can easily update cell values and manage data records directly through the interface.

For tables requiring mathematical operations, you can utilize Formula columns. These features allow you to perform calculations automatically based on other column values. Furthermore, some plans include front-end editing, which lets users update data instantly from the website view.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is there a free trial for the full version of wpDataTables?

No, a direct free trial is not offered for the full plugin. However, all new subscriptions include a 15-day money-back guarantee, letting you test the complete features risk-free. A limited free version is also available on WordPress.org.

How does the licensing model handle multiple websites or domain limits?

Licensing is based on the number of domains supported per year. Starter and Standard plans cover one domain, Pro covers three domains, and the Developer plan supports unlimited domains. This allows you to choose a plan that matches your deployment scale.

Which plan do I need if I want to connect to external databases like MySQL or PostgreSQL?

External connections to MySQL, MSSQL, or PostgreSQL are available starting with the Standard annual plan. The entry-level Starter plan does not include these advanced external connection features.

Is the subscription based on per-user seats or on features and domain usage?

The subscription is tied only to the features included and the number of allowed domains. The licensing is not based on per-user or per-seat models, and all plans include unlimited tables and charts.

What happens to my data and functionality if I choose not to renew my annual license?

If you do not renew, the plugin will remain fully functional, and you will not lose any data. However, you will stop receiving monthly updates, new features, and access to the premium support system.

Can I pull data directly into my tables from external APIs or JSON feeds?

Yes, you can easily create tables using external APIs through JSON feeds and nested JSON data. All plans also include the capability to connect directly via the Google Sheet API.

Can I upgrade my license later if my business grows and I need more domains?

Of course! You can easily upgrade your license to a higher tier at any time. You just contact the support team, and you only need to pay the difference in cost between the two plans.

Which plan is best suited for agencies managing many client projects?

The Developer plan is explicitly recommended for agencies, developers, and freelancers. It provides the full feature set and supports deployment across an unlimited number of client domains.

What kind of support is included with an annual subscription?

All annual subscription plans include one year of premium support. This gives you direct access to the team, which is widely praised for its responsiveness and helpfulness.

Does wpDataTables provide integration specifically for WooCommerce for e-commerce sites?

Yes, WooCommerce integration is a key feature starting with the Pro plan. This capability helps e-commerce sites create dynamic product listings and comparison tables.

What payment methods are accepted for buying a license?

You can use PayPal, Visa, MasterCard, or American Express to complete your purchase. If you need to use a different method, you should contact the provider directly.
